<p>It appears that along each wand used in Harry Potter movies and books is directly proportion with the height from the wizard the master of it and since all these has rather unique properties, only its owner has got the right and power to use it. Aspiring wizards are prone to causing severe damage if they play one which is available in conflict with his or her character. It doesn't mean that wands cannot change owners. In order for a wand to be used by another character, its master should be killed, stunned or disarmed so the wand will recognize the "attacker" to be its new master. Simply taking it from another wizard's hands isn't acceptable.</p>

It is a popular proven fact that in 99% of the cases it is the wand that chooses its wizard, not vice-versa. There are 4 total famous Harry Potter wands, as follows: The first is made of holly wood also it measured 11 inches. It's known for being supple and nice and it had been broken in December 1997 when it flew from Godric's Hollow. At the core of the wand lies a Phoenix feather. The second Harry Potter wand was made from blackthorn, taken by Ron Weasley from a Snatcher back in 1997. Harry tried on the extender until 1998, until he obtained wand number 3. The hawthorn wand measured 10 inches also it was taken from Draco Malfoy. That one became Harry's after the Skirmish at Malfoy Manor. At its core lied unicorn hair and Harry used it until he gained possession of the Elder Wand. Wand number 4 is probably the most famous and po
werful wand Harry Potter ever used. It was made of elder wood and measures 15 inches. He only tried on the extender once using the goal of repairing his phoenix wand. After using it, he returned it to Albus Dumbledore's grave. </p>

<p>Although these Harry Potter wands are famous, they're mainly some examples of magic tools utilized in Harry Potter movies and books. There are many other wands made of wood for example chestnut, oak, cherry or willow, wands used by other characters like Ron Weasley, Rubeus Hagrid or Peter Pettigrew.
